1. Home Advantage: How much a team's results improve on their own ground versus on the road — a combined signal from both attack and defence.

2. Scored: Compares goals scored per game at home against goals scored per game away. A positive figure means the team finds the net more easily at home.

3. Defence: Compares goals conceded per game at home against goals conceded away. A positive figure means the team keeps opponents quieter on their own turf.

The combined Home Advantage score is the average of the Scoring and Defence figures, weighted equally.

Goal-based metrics give a sharper picture of home performance than win/loss records alone, since they reflect the margin of each match.
